Spin valves work because of a quantum property of electrons (and other particles) called spin. Due to a split in the density of states of electrons at the Fermi energy in ferromagnets, there is a net spin polarisation. In this EMC experiment, a quark of a polarized proton target was hit by a polarized muon beam, and the quark's instantaneous spin was measured. In a polarized proton target, all the protons' spins take the same direction, and therefore it was expected that the spin of two out of the three quarks cancels out and the spin of the third quark is polarized in the direction of the proton's spin.
A locknut, also known as a lock nut, locking nut, self-locking nut, prevailing torque nut, [1] stiff nut [1] or elastic stop nut, [2] is a nut that resists loosening under vibrations and torque. Prevailing torque nuts have some portion of the nut that deforms elastically to provide a locking action. [ 2 ]
